What is an Injury Compensation Attorney?

An injury compensation attorney is an attorney concentrated on representing customers who have actually been injured due to the carelessness or misdeed of another party. This could include a range of occurrences, consisting of car accidents, work environment injuries, medical malpractice, and item liability cases. Their main objective is to ensure that their clients receive reasonable compensation for their injuries, covering medical costs, lost earnings, and discomfort and suffering.

When to Hire an Injury Compensation Attorney

Not every minor injury requires legal representation; however, there are numerous situations where employing an injury compensation attorney is recommended:

  1. Severe Injuries: If you sustained significant injuries requiring substantial medical treatment, legal assistance can help browse intricate claims.

  2. Contested Liability: When there is unpredictability over who is at fault for the accident, an attorney can collect proof and construct an engaging case.

  3. Insurer: If the insurer is refusing to pay a claim or offers a settlement that does not cover the complete level of damages, an attorney can advocate for a more appropriate resolution.

  4. Complex Cases: Cases involving multiple parties, such as multi-vehicle accidents or workplace injuries involving employers and 3rd parties, require legal knowledge.

  5. Long-Term Effects: For injuries that might have long-term repercussions, such as persistent pain or special needs, an attorney can assist to ensure that future medical expenses are considered.

The Injury Compensation Claim Process

Navigating the accident claim procedure can be challenging without legal competence. Here is a basic summary of the actions included when working with an injury compensation attorney:

  1. Initial Consultation: Most lawyers use totally free initial assessments, allowing potential customers to discuss their cases without financial dedication.

  2. Case Investigation: The attorney will collect proof, interview witnesses, and review medical records to construct a strong case.

  3. Suing: After collecting adequate evidence, the attorney will sue with the proper insurer or, if necessary, get ready for litigation.

  4. Negotiation: The attorney will negotiate with the insurer to protect a reasonable settlement for the hurt party.

  5. Litigation: If the settlement negotiations do not yield satisfactory outcomes, the attorney might file a lawsuit and represent the customer in court.

  6. Resolution: The case concludes either through a settlement or a court judgment, at which point the attorney will make sure that the client receives compensation.
